"Sequela" is a word in LAW AND LEGAL, ENGLISH
L. Lat. In old English law. Suit; process or prosecution. Sequela cans#, the process of a cause. Cowell
An adherent, or a band or sect of adherents.
One who, or that which, follows.
That which follows as the logical result of reasoning;
inference; conclusion; suggestion.
A morbid phenomenon left as the result of a disease; a
disease resulting from another.
